Talks end in contrasting assessments
China Daily | Updated: 2019-10-07 06:55
DPRK says Saturday's meeting broke down while US hails 'good discussions'
STOCKHOLM - The Democratic People's Republic of Korea and the United States walked away on Saturday with opposing assessments of nuclear talks in Sweden, which Pyongyang said broke down but Washington called "good discussions".
"The negotiations did not live up to our expectations and were canceled. I am very disappointed," DPRK's chief negotiator Kim Myonggil told the Republic of Korea's Yonhap news agency after the talks.
